Title:
1-5 RARE EARTH-COBALT MAGNET MATERIAL POWDER FOR SINTERED MAGNET

Abstract:

PURPOSE: To obtain the magnet material suitable for a highly efficient sintered magnet by a method wherein the composition of 1-5 rare earth-Co magnet material powder to be used for the sintered magnet is set as Sm1-xPrxCoz, and values x and z are selected with in prescribed range.

CONSTITUTION: The prescribed quantity of high purity Sm2O3, Pr6O11, Co and metal Ca powder are mixed, they are processed in Ar at 1,100°C for 3hr and then cooled quickly. A reaction product is put into water, and CaO and unreacted Ca are removed using water and dilute acid. The moisture adhered to the powder is substituted with C2H5OH, the powder is wet-pulverized, dried up by deaeration, and the alloy powder of Sm1-xPrxCoz of 0.05≤x≤0.39 and 4.2≤z≤4.7 is obtained. When a sintered magnet is formed using said powder, its residual magnetic flux density Br and magnetic coersive force HC become high, and its maximum energy product BHmax is increased too.
